I strongly urge all who fondly remembered "Starmites" during its ill-fated yet Tony- nominated Broadway run to buy this CD. With a charming & witty score by Barry Keating, "Starmites" tells the lively story of a girl who loves science-fiction comic books and gets swept away into "Innerspace", where she meets all sort of Good guys (the "Starmites") and Bad guys (the wild Diva and her evil Banshees). You get to hear a young Liz Larsen, (most recently in "A New Brain") Gabriel Barre, Victor Trent Cook (currently in "Smokey Joe's Cafe"), Gwen Stewart (currently in "Rent"), Mary Kate Law (currently in "The Sound of Music") and many other talented performers. Good triumphs over evil with brilliant vocal arrangements. A must for any musical theater buff.

Science Fiction meets Off-Broadway in a fantastic musical that will keep every theater-goer entertained. Every song will stick with you, and some may even inspire you. Starmites is unique because it's about a topic that not many musicals touch upon- outerspace (or Innerspace, as the case may be). Gwen Stewart is amazing as the Diva. Standout songs include "Reach Right Down", "Superhero Girl", "Diva!", "Milady", "It Wasn't A Dream", and "Immolation". See, there's just so much great music! Starmites is truly a gem, and Amazon.com is the only place I've seen it being sold. Get this CD, and you'll be glad you did. It's a unique story and a musical that you can fall in love with.

This is truly a cute show! The lyrics and songs maybe a bit simple at times, but the story is about a little girl and her comic book, so it fits very nicely. I will have to say that Barry Keating might be the next Menken/Ashmen! It's hard to summarize the story per just the recording, but the music is a mix between "Little Shop Of Horrors" and "Starlight Express". For people who buy cast recordings on a whim, this is one you will want to pick up!
